Telematics & Fleet Monitoring Administrator Arndell Park N.S.W or Melbourne Victoria

The Role on Offer -

Were se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Telematics & Fleet Monitoring Administrator to join our Arndell Park N.S.W or Melbourne-based team. This role is pivotal in ensuring the smooth operation of our telematics systems and fleet monitoring processes. Youll be the go-to person for managing inquiries coordinating vendor services maintaining documentation and supporting operational efficiency across our business units.

Key Responsibilities and Duties but not limited to -

  • Manage team inbox and coordinate internal communications escalating issues as needed.

  • Maintain telematics documentation logs and hardware inventory to support system integrity.

  • Generate distribute and support reporting tasks from telematics platforms and fleet systems.

  • Raise and manage Work Orders and Purchase Orders to resolve faults and coordinate field service.

  • Liaise with internal stakeholders and external vendors to ensure timely resolution of requests.

  • Support compliance activities including insurance registration fuel usage and fleet standards.

  • Assist with scheduling training and continuous improvement initiatives across telematics operations.

What youll bring for success in this role -

  • Strong organisational and communication skills.

  • Experience in administrative support roles ideally in transport or logistics.

  • Familiarity with telematics systems and ERP platforms (Oracle UNIBIS) with proficiency in Microsoft office suites.

  • Experience in vendor coordination and procurement processes.

  • Working knowledge of heavy vehicles and HVNL legislation.

  • Ability to multitask meet deadlines and solve problems analytically with a collaborative resilient and detail-oriented mindset
